How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 46256?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
46256 Studio Apartments | $1,181 | $947 | $1,369 |
46256 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,258 | $840 | $2,292 |
46256 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,504 | $970 | $3,062 |
46256 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,920 | $699 | $3,220 |
46256 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,542 | $1,430 | $1,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ly the 46256 ZIP Code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ly 46256 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in 46256 is $1,364.
What is the largest Pet Friendly 46256 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in 46256 is a 1,412 square feet unit starting from $1,360 at Four Seasons Apartments & Townhomes.
What is the average size for 46256 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in 46256 is currently at 831 sq ft.
